Default Linking an Excel Spreadsheet in Word

I'm trying to link a spreadsheet into a Word document. When I InsertObject
and link the file, the spreadsheet includes other columns that are not in the
print area. Also, only one page will be inserted. (It's a 5-page
spreadsheet.) The "set print area" is correct. (By the way, it's important
that the spreadsheet is linked.)

I tried copy and paste special, but that only appears very small and still
on one page in Word.

I'm using Word and Excel 2003.
